# bernstein-mcp
Stateless, read-only MCP endpoint at **https://mcp.bernstein.run** that verifies
[bernstein](https://github.com/sipyourdrink-ltd/bernstein) run receipts and
hash chains. No account, no key, nothing stored, nothing fetched.

## What it does
| Tool | Result |
|---|---|
| `verify_receipt` | recomputes every chain a run receipt embeds, rebuilds the signed subject, checks the Ed25519 signature; verdict + one line per check, plus the verdict as a signed statement (below) |
| `explain_receipt` | the same verification, narrated: what the run recorded, where it diverges, what the result does and does not prove |
| `verify_chain` | walks journal rows, lineage entries or audit events on their own (pass the file text for byte-exact rows); names the first broken link |
| `list_presets` / `get_preset` | the compliance presets this release ships |
| `list_adapters` | the agent adapters bundled with this release |
| `server_info` | version and limits |
Same walk as `bernstein verify-receipt`, reachable from any MCP client or the
paste form at [/verify](https://mcp.bernstein.run/verify). A verdict's page
address is the receipt's own digest.
## Trust model
| Proves | Does not prove |
|---|---|
| the embedded rows are exactly the rows that were signed | that the embedded key belongs to who you think (trust-on-first-use; pin the operator's published key yourself) |
| nothing was edited, reordered, dropped or appended after signing | audit-range HMAC values (keyed by the producing install; their linkage and content hash are still checked) |
Pass the receipt file's contents as a **string**: an already parsed object
cannot tell `1` from `1.0`, and the reference hashes the original spelling.
## Signed verdicts
Every verdict comes back as a [DSSE](https://github.com/secure-systems-lab/dsse)
envelope (`signed_verdict`) signed with this deployment's Ed25519 key: the
payload is a JCS-canonical statement naming the receipt by digest, the
verdict, every check, and an `appraisal` block in the EAR status vocabulary
(`affirming` / `contraindicated` / `none`). Keep it next to the receipt;
anyone can re-check it offline against the public key at
[/.well-known/bernstein-mcp/keys.json](https://mcp.bernstein.run/.well-known/bernstein-mcp/keys.json)
(`kid` = RFC 7638 thumbprint). The signature covers the DSSE PAE of
`application/vnd.bernstein.verdict+json`, the same construction the receipt
itself uses. It attests that *this verifier reached this verdict for these
bytes at this time* — nothing about the receipt's producer.
## Limits
| | |
|---|---|
| Request body | 1 MiB |
| Rows per chain | 2 000 (larger receipts: verify locally) |
| Rate | 60 requests/min per address on `POST /mcp` and `POST /verify` |
| Logging | one JSON line per request: route, method, status, JSON-RPC method, tool, verdict, MCP client name/version, country, colo. Never the address, a header, the body or the receipt |
## Correctness
`vectors/` holds eight golden vectors generated by the Python reference
(`scripts/gen_vectors.py` against the pinned bernstein source). The
TypeScript verifier must reproduce each vector's verdict, every check, the
binding bytes and the receipt digest byte for byte (`test/vectors.test.ts`).
